"If you are traveling Zhongshan with family, this is a great lodging option. It has a living space with an open kitchen. Washer in the the balcony. A dining area next to the kitchen plus a bathroom. We stayed in a family suite so there are two bedrooms upstairs. One of them is a master room with a bathroom. It’s inexpensive with a great value. The only thing is that it’s an apartmental so there are no amenities. If you want a hotel with a pool/restaurants/bar, there’s Even Hotel nextdoor in the same plaza or Hilton by the Lihe mall. They are great deals also in American standard. And Zhongshan Perth Lodge is a steal less than half the price compared to those two, and most ideal for family or if you want to have guests over (since there’s a living room). Location is the best, it’s next to a couple big malls including MIXC and Holiday Plaza. Holiday Plaza is very artistic with lots of small boutique shops and restaurants, although the shops aren’t cheap. For example, a piece of clothes can be 300-600RMB, very expensive in China standard. Whereas a night at Perth was less than 300 RMB, so you get the idea. MIXC is a higher end mall with international and local brands like Adidas, Popmart, Uniqlo etc. Across from Perth, there’s a foot massage place called Xiheli, that requires calling in advance to book. Directly downstairs from Perth there’s Lawson which opens 24 hrs. Overall, it’s a good accommodation in a perfect location. Highly recommend!"

What can I expect from the weather during my trip to Zhongshan?
Weather is only one factor, but it can really affect your travel plans, especially if you're planning an extended stay in Zhongshan. The hottest months are usually July and August, with an average temperature of 29°C, while the coldest months are January and December, with an average of 18°C. The rainiest months in Zhongshan are June, August, May and September, with each month seeing an average of 320 mm of rainfall.

What's the best way to get to and around Zhongshan?
Knowing a bit about the transportation options can you save you a headache when you get to your destination. Fly into Macau (MFM-Macau Intl.), which is located 27.6 mi (44.4 km) away from the heart of the city. Otherwise, look for flights into Shenzhen (SZX-Shenzhen Intl.), which is 28.5 mi (45.9 km) away. To explore the surrounding area, ride one of the trains from Zhongshan North Station or Zhongshan Railway Station.
